Output 3b3c9fe28f8724891f9d52b8f0b6e0960522e9dd8fc5624f86af6a6540d0ffc8:0

value
2724273068
script pubkey
OP_0 OP_PUSHBYTES_20 8b004076daefe12447c42830e1c421611e2d4b4a
address
tb1q3vqyqak6alsjg37y9qcwr3ppvy0z6j62ge60rx
transaction
3b3c9fe28f8724891f9d52b8f0b6e0960522e9dd8fc5624f86af6a6540d0ffc8
confirmations
109318
spent
true